Let's take a closer look at the characteristics of the R3G190-RC05-03 centrifugal fan today, and see what unique features it has among many fans.
Firstly, its efficient ventilation capability is a significant feature. As mentioned earlier, its maximum air volume can reach 735m³/h and its maximum pressure is 450Pa. This combination of parameters makes it perform exceptionally well in terms of ventilation and air exchange. In some places that require a large amount of air exchange, such as workshops in small factories, various exhaust gases and heat are generated during the production process. If the ventilation is not good, it can affect the health and production efficiency of workers. The R3G190-RC05-03 centrifugal fan, with its high air volume, can quickly exhaust the polluted air in the workshop while introducing fresh air to maintain the freshness of the air in the workshop. The higher pressure ensures that air can flow smoothly in the ventilation duct, even if there is some resistance in the duct, it will not affect the ventilation effect.

Energy saving is also an important feature of this fan. Although its input power is 83W, considering the large air volume and high pressure it provides, this power is relatively reasonable. It adopts efficient impeller design and high-quality motor, which can more effectively convert electrical energy into kinetic energy of air. The optimized design of the impeller reduces energy loss during air flow and improves ventilation efficiency. High performance motors have lower energy consumption and higher efficiency, which can reduce energy consumption while ensuring ventilation effect. For places that require long-term continuous operation of ventilation equipment, energy conservation means that a significant amount of electricity costs can be saved, which is very attractive for both businesses and users.
